Cost
Cost of a new Audi Key can be different based on many variables, such as the year and type of the key. You can save a lot of these expenses by taking your vehicle to an auto locksmith or dealer to get the key replaced.
The most expensive option is to buy a new key directly from the manufacturer. This will cost between $280 and $475. Additional fees will be charged to program the key to your specific model.
Another option is to buy keys from a locksmith who can cut and program a transponder code for you. This can save you a lot of time and money.
They are also known as smart key fobs. They are used to unlock your doors or start your engine using a push button activation. They also come with a panic alarm that will sound if you lock the doors or if the battery goes down.
Most key fobs are battery operated which means they must be replaced each and every time. They can be found at hardware stores, AutoZone, or from an locksmith shop.
A new key for an Audi could be more expensive than keys from a different make of car. This is due to the immobilizer system of the Audi is more complex than ones in Japanese or American automobiles.
To activate the immobilizer your Audi key must be programmed. This requires a technician with experience and special tools for this procedure.
Programming these keys can take as long as an hour. In order to complete the task, you will have to have all your keys both new and old.
If you're not sure whether your key fob is required to be reprogrammedor not, ask your local Audi dealer or locksmith for a quote. Compare it to prices at other locations, such as online retailers or auto repair shops.
You can also go with a mobile locksmith, who will travel to your location and design the key from scratch in their van. This is a less expensive and faster option than going to a dealership.
